Output f75ab3e40622d06e8e39624c105bcc8820ee489003266f3b57a0e24e8c37a3fa:2

value
61388372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f23d170a9cac7ebeb1dde684e5b84bd17f35401 OP_EQUAL
address
35zGbFGN3HHUoSWKuoz2h1Y5Q8XQ5krvXE
transaction
f75ab3e40622d06e8e39624c105bcc8820ee489003266f3b57a0e24e8c37a3fa
spent
true